Julia Sorensen on Why Healthcare Innovation Doesn’t Require a Big Budget
Julia Sorensen, VP of Marketing at Mass General Brigham, shares how her unconventional path from EMS and clinical social work to healthcare marketing shaped her approach to problem-solving and leadership. She explains why smaller organizations may have an innovation advantage, how marketers can build community trust through low-cost engagement, and why measuring ROI is essential. Julia also offers a practical framework for using AI to improve personal productivity, test new ideas, and streamline workflows without chasing every shiny new tool. The conversation concludes with advice for creating space for experimentation and a look at how Julia’s work as an artist fuels her creativity beyond healthcare.
